關於點擊TableviewCell的子內容收放問題,拿到它的第一個思路就是, 方法一: 運用UITableview本身的代理來處理相應的展開收起: .代理: void tableView: UITableView tableView didSelectRowAtIndexPath: NSIndexPath indexPath .需要聲明一個全局BOOL變量isOpen,記錄當前cell的狀態 展開 ...
2016-05-18 15:55 0 2361 推薦指數:
UITableView中cell點擊的絢麗動畫效果 本人視頻教程系類 iOS中CALayer的使用 效果圖: 源碼: YouXianMingCell.h 與 YouXianMingCell.m 控制器源碼: 測試 ...
UITableView給我們提供了一個非常不錯的展示列表的工具。內置了復用機制,其中的Cell按照一般的寫法就可以實現服用,不用在Cell滾動的時候每次都創建一個新的。實現了非常好的用戶體驗。但是,有的時候在某些場景下我們需要的不是復用。我們會自己創建好所有需要的Cell,並放在 ...
查過文檔,官方提供了– visibleCells 方法來獲取所有可見的cell,但是僅限於獲取當前能看到的,那些需要scroll才能看到的cell獲取不到。於是想到自己寫: 復制代碼 -(NSArray ...
在使用UITableView時,由於cell的重用機制,在獲取后台數據並填充cell時,會發生cell重復出現,界面紊亂。但這僅僅在擁有多個section的情況下會出現,沒有滾動的時候,單個section的row顯示的都是正確的。 以下是示例代碼: 這里面的變量 ...
"UITableView" iOS開發中重量級的控件之一;在日常開發中我們大多數會選擇自定Cell來滿足自己開發中的需求, 但是有些時候Cell也是可以不自定義的(比如某一個簡單的頁面,只需要展示一些簡單的信息);但是當頁面大於屏幕顯示的范圍的時候, 滑動UITableView的時候,Cell ...
1、動畫cell 針對cell的動畫,在Delegate中對cell的layer進行操作: 2、實現代碼 3、附件:TableView的Delegate和DataSource的方法簡介(iOS11.0 ...
- (UITableViewCellEditingStyle)tableView:(UITableView *)tableView editingStyleForRowAtIndexPath:(NSIndexPath *)indexPath //當在Cell ...